When it comes to versatile piping solutions, HDPE pipes are among the best options available. These high-density polyethylene pipes are durable, flexible, and resistant to a wide range of chemicals. Let’s explore the various uses of HDPE pipes.

1. Water Supply Systems

One of the primary uses of HDPE pipe is in water supply systems. "Are they suitable for drinking water?" you might ask. Yes! HDPE pipes are safe for transporting potable water. They are lightweight and easy to install, making them a preferred choice for utility companies.

2. Sewer and Drainage Systems

Another significant application is in sewer and drainage systems. HDPE pipes can handle wastewater efficiently. "Why is that important?" Well, their smooth interior reduces friction, allowing waste to flow quickly.

3. Irrigation

Farmers also benefit from HDPE pipes for irrigation purposes. "How do they help with farming?" they allow for efficient water distribution. Their flexibility means they can be easily adapted to fit different landscapes, ensuring crops receive adequate water.

4. Industrial Applications

Industries utilize HDPE pipes for various applications. They are ideal for transporting chemicals and other materials. When discussing durability, a factory manager might say, "These pipes handle the tough stuff without corroding." It’s a win for both performance and cost-effectiveness.

5. Gas Distribution

HDPE pipes are also widely used in gas distribution. "Can they really handle gas?" Absolutely! Their structure ensures safety and performance, making them reliable for transporting natural gas and other gases.

6. Telecommunications

Did you know that HDPE pipes are used in telecommunications? "Really? How does that work?" They serve as conduits for fiber optic cables, protecting them from environmental factors. This ensures faster and more reliable communication services.

7. Geothermal Applications

In geothermal systems, HDPE pipes are crucial. They are resistant to high temperatures and abrasions. "That sounds essential for heating," someone might ponder. Indeed, these pipes can enhance energy efficiency and longevity in heating applications.

8. Mining Projects

The mining industry also takes advantage of HDPE pipes. They are used for slurry pipelines and dewatering applications. "Why are they preferred here?" Their resistance to wear and tear makes them ideal for harsh conditions often found in mining.
